Macro Syntax to copy and paste dynamic data based on one column



I am trying to move data around from one sheet to another I am currently
using the following:

Sub Quotesheet2()
'If each column has a heading, change the 1's to 2's
Dim myRange As Range
Dim ActSheet As Worksheet
Dim newSheet As Worksheet
Set ActSheet = ActiveSheet
With ActSheet
Set myRange = .Range("A1", .Range("A1").End(xlDown))
End With
Set newSheet = ActiveWorkbook.Sheets("Sheet1") '<-- in the new workbook
myRange.Copy _
With ActSheet
Set myRange = .Range("B1", .Range("B1").End(xlDown))
End With
myRange.Copy _
With ActSheet
Set myRange = .Range("c1", .Range("c1").End(xlDown))
End With
myRange.Copy _
With ActSheet
Set myRange = .Range("d1", .Range("d1").End(xlDown))
End With
myRange.Copy _
End Sub

The problem that I am running into is that this data is changing constantly
and only one column has data that is consistently complete (column "A"). I
am looking for a way to look at column "A" and move data based on the
information in column "A" so for example if I have data in column "A"
(A1:A10). The macro will put the information from column "B" in column "C"
where column "A" left off. It then copies information in column "C" and
paste down. It then copies Column "D" and paste where column "C" left off
(but I am looking for a way where it will paste the same range as column "A").

Thank You in advance


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ments. After that, you can post your question and our members will help you out.

Ask a Question
